When the TV edit of FUNimation's in-house dub of Dragon Ball aired on Toonami USA, a new opening was created for it, although "Romantic Ageru Yo" was left intact (albeit a shortened version). But what did prints of the edited dub outside of Toonami USA use for the opening (such as prints from Australia and New Zealand)? I'd imagine they'd use a shortened version of "Makafushigi Adventure".

That's wasn't an opening. That was a bumper. Right after the "stand by for Dragon Ball Z..." it would enter the standard opening theme for whatever season they were up to (and I'm thinking it was abysmal, ear bleed-inducing "rock" instrumental opening from the garlic Jr saga).

you are correct. heck the blue water db dub had TWO different openings for their edited dragon ball. one for the uk one for canada(both based off the french version though). funi was far from the only one to have custom openings.

I remember Toonami UK would occasionally slip up and air the Canadian DB opening and ending instead of their own. Sometimes they'd even play both versions one after the other, so you'd have 2 completely different openings for 1 episode.
